infrakit: Fix detection of running proceses
os.FindProcess() does not return an error when then process does not exist. It even returns a dummy process object. Use the go-ps package to find out if the hyperkit process is actually running. Signed-off-by: Rolf Neugebauer <rolf.neugebauer@docker.com>
